Eventos del sistema de ingestión de datos
Evento de finalización de procesamiento
ProcessingComplete se emite cuando los ProcessedEntryResponses tienen resultado SUCCESS y el tamaño de las respuestas es mayor que cero. Cuando se emite este evento, se expone la métrica llamada ipf_file_ingestion_processing_finished con el resultado SUCCESS, junto con processName y fileName.
Evento de procesamiento fallido
ProcessingFailedEvent se emite cuando ocurre un error durante la ejecución de la definición de procesamiento. Cuando se emite este evento, se expone la métrica llamada ipf_file_ingestion_processing_finished con el resultado FAILED, junto con processName y fileName.
Evento de procesamiento omitido
El evento Processing Skipped se emite cuando se intenta ingerir un archivo no corrupto desde un directorio que no corresponde al archivo que se está ingiriendo (p. ej., un intento de ingestión de Bank Directory Plus desde el directorio destinado a IBANPlus). En este escenario, la ingestión del archivo no procede, el archivo se mueve al directorio Archive y se emite el evento Processing Skipped.
Evento de entrada de archivo procesada
FileEntryProcessedEvent se emite por cada entrada que se procesa correctamente. Cuando se emite este evento, se expone la métrica llamada ipf_file_ingestion_file_entry_processed, junto con entryId y fileName.
Evento de entrada de archivo omitida
FileEntrySkippedEvent se emite cuando una entrada de BankMasterConcatenated con bankMasterConcatenated.getIid() no tiene una entrada asociada de tipo Bank Master. Cuando se emite este evento, se expone la métrica llamada ipf_file_ingestion_file_entry_processed con bankMasterConcatenatedIid, fileName y un mensaje apropiado. Se emite solo para archivos BankMaster.